Job Description
PhonePe Group is seeking a Firmware Engineer to contribute to the development of firmware solutions for its devices, including smart speakers and DQR devices. The candidate will collaborate with cross-functional teams to define firmware requirements, design, develop, and test firmware solutions, and optimize code for efficient resource utilization. The role involves staying updated with industry trends and documenting firmware designs.
Responsibilities:
- Collaborate with cross-functional teams to define firmware requirements.
- Design, develop, and test firmware solutions for smart speakers.
- Implement firmware features to support smart speakers and IoT devices.
- Optimize firmware code and algorithms for efficient resource utilization.
- Conduct thorough testing and debugging of firmware.
- Collaborate with the QA team to develop test plans.
- Stay up-to-date with industry trends and advancements.
- Document firmware designs, specifications, and development processes.
Requirements:
- Bachelor's or Master's degree in Electrical Engineering, Computer Engineering, or a related field.
- Experience in firmware development for embedded systems.
- Strong programming skills in Java/C/C++.
- Experience with hardware-software integration.
- Knowledge of hardware architectures, microcontrollers, and peripheral interfaces.
- Familiarity with wireless communication protocols.
- Experience with device drivers and firmware debugging techniques.
- Understanding of software development practices.
- Ability to work independently and in a team environment.
- Passion for hardware, firmware development, and device integration.
PhonePe offers:
- Insurance Benefits
- Wellness Program
- Parental Support
- Mobility Benefits
- Retirement Benefits
- Other Benefits like Higher Education Assistance and Car Lease